This Best Meatball Sub recipe is a delicious and satisfying meal that combines flavorful meatballs in marinara sauce, topped with melted mozzarella cheese, all nestled in a warm sub roll. It’s a classic favorite for lunch or dinner!
Ingredients
Scale
Meatballs:
- 1 pound ground beef
- ½ pound ground pork
- ½ cup breadcrumbs
- 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 egg
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
- 1 te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on black pepper
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
Other:
- 2 cups marinara sauce
- 4 sub rolls or hoagie buns
- 1 ½ cups shredded mozzarella cheese
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
Instructions
- Preheat the oven: Preheat the oven to 400°F.
- Prepare the meatballs: In a large bowl, combine ground beef, ground pork, breadcrumbs, Parmesan, egg, garlic, parsley, sal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ning. Shape into meatballs and bake for 15–18 minutes.
- Warm marinara sauce: Heat marinara sauce in a saucepan.
- Combine meatballs and sauce: Transfer baked meatballs to the sauce and simmer for 5 minutes.
- Toast the rolls: Slice and lightly toast sub rolls with olive oil.
- Assemble the subs: Fill rolls with meatballs and sauce, top with mozzarella cheese.
- Melt the cheese: Broil the subs for 2–3 minutes until cheese is melted.
- Serve: Enjoy hot!
Notes
- For extra flavor, use garlic butter to toast the sub rolls.
- You can substitute ground turkey or chicken for a lighter version.
- Store leftover meatballs in sauce for up to 3 days in the fridge.
